PooPourri the marker of deodorizing toilet spray has dropped its latest doozy- this time talking about how to poop at parties.

“We have a very specific, delicate brand voice that is purposely hard to pull off,” Nicole Story, the lead director for Number 2 Productions (PooPourris’ inhouse production company), told Adweek. “By bringing production in-house, we have full control.”

“We had a strategy meeting with [YouTube parent company] Google earlier this year, and after we left that meeting,” he explained, “they affirmed that this is exactly where we needed to take the brand and the company.”
